Of course, not all bonuses are created equal. Some platforms dangle flashy numbers but hide complex conditions behind the scenes. The wagering requirement is the first thing savvy players examine — it tells you how many times you must bet the bonus amount (and sometimes the deposit itself) before you can withdraw any winnings derived from it. A lower wagering multiplier, such as 30x or 35x, is generally more player-friendly than a hefty 50x. Additionally, keep an eye on any caps placed on maximum bet sizes while the bonus is active, alongside the list of eligible games. Slots usually contribute 100% to wagering, whereas table games might only count a fraction or even nothing at all.
Let us walk through a realistic scenario. Suppose you decide to claim a match bonus that doubles your deposit up to a certain cap. You deposit €100, and the platform credits you with an additional €100 in bonus funds. Now you have €200 to play with — but that does not mean you can immediately request a withdrawal. Instead, you need to meet the specified rollover conditions, which typically involve playing through the combined amount (deposit plus bonus) a set number of times. This is where strategy kicks in. Choosing games with a higher contribution rate and lower volatility can help you preserve your balance longer while working through the requirements.
Another element that often goes unnoticed is the time window attached to the bonus. Many platforms require you to fulfil the wagering within a certain number of days, usually ranging from a week to a month. If you let the deadline slide, the bonus and any associated winnings simply vanish. Consequently, it is wise to skim the terms before you commit — a ten-minute read can save you from unnecessary disappointment later. The same applies to the minimum deposit threshold; failing to meet it means the bonus never activates in the first place.

One more subtlety deserves attention: the distinction between a sticky bonus and a non-sticky one. A sticky bonus remains locked on your account until you meet the wagering, and you can only withdraw winnings, not the bonus itself. A non-sticky bonus, on the other hand, gets removed from your balance immediately once you start playing with your own money, leaving your deposit free for withdrawal at any time. Both models have their merits, but knowing which one you are dealing with shapes your entire approach to the bonus.
